Output ef8c1a49ae231362d9233209614ba7e2ba01da801ee596f8d9e9673a67bd151a:0

value
1489890250
script pubkey
OP_0 OP_PUSHBYTES_20 1e2f1578dbd4a2dd3e6c44cf68acfeda2e20c684
address
bc1qrch327xm6j3d60nvgn8k3t87mghzp35yfaqet9
transaction
ef8c1a49ae231362d9233209614ba7e2ba01da801ee596f8d9e9673a67bd151a
spent
true